Transaction 296899ebe659700301113ab2865138487238b91ebac491db97096fe7c4d2dcc2
1 Input
1 Output
-
296899ebe659700301113ab2865138487238b91ebac491db97096fe7c4d2dcc2:0
- value
- 4107405
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57f3da4d11e1d6faf7a8a7345fb489a313a00f7d OP_EQUAL
- address
- 39i4qRDRwRLEa2HM1rGLxRT9TnVQR5xSFD